Description

The International Yearbook for Hermeneutics represents one of the prominent currents in contemporary philosophy as well as in bordering disciplines.

It gathers studies on questions concerning understanding and interpretation in all relevant fields, including philosophy, theology, jurisprudence, theory of science as well as literary and cultural studies.

The Yearbook includes contributions to current debates and on the history of ideas from antiquity to the present.

This volume focusses on "Interpretation - Understanding - Knowledge."
